To provide a fair review, I attempted to interview the girls and get their feedback. Ummm, I didn't get far with them because they were quickly distracted by a squirrel pooping on our porch. With that, I would have to go with my opinion as a parent. We love it. Lorrie, the owner and teacher, is organized, methodical and fun. She's appropriately strict and the kids learn confidence and discipline (but not like the kind you learn in a Shaolin KungFu temple). The highlight is the annual dance recital that's held in a large theater. I was pleasantly surprised by the high production level, especially since the performers are mostly still wearing diapers. The dance studio is in the Junction and it's quite clean and comfortable. The classroom is large and appropriately padded. The waiting room for the parents has comfy chairs but could use some more current magazines. There's a change room and two washrooms. The bonus is there are a ton of things to do around the studio while your kid is in class. You can shop for organic food at The Sweet Potato, grab the best cup of coffee at Crema or indulge with a yummy Bronto Burger. We love it.

My daughter has been attending classes at Laurie's studio since she was 2 1/2 and absolutely loves…read moreit (she's now 10 1/2). She has taken creative movers, tap, jazz, modern and musical theatre - but her favorites are definitely modern and jazz. She loves that each instructor she has had has given her plenty of opportunity to shine and she always leaves class energized. Creative Children's Dance Centre has not only enhanced her love of dance, but given her the opportunity to explore movement and gain confidence she carries beyond the studio. There are a good mix of boys and girls attending and the performances are truly spectacular to watch. Obviously I'm biased to love my daughters performances the most, the the tap and hip hop always get the audience excited and the ballet goes from adorable (the tiny performers) to inspiring as the more experienced intensive training or pre professional dancers grace the stage. As the previous reviewer said, the studio is clean and comfortable. The location is ideally situated among many distractions for parents (coffee shops, gyms, shopping) as well. The instructors are all lovely and the owner, Laurie is one of my daughters personal favorites.

Incident Jan 27th: My daughter completes her dance class and is getting dressed to go home... but wait...her running shoes are missing!!! I go into that change room looked in the lost and found... cubbies...corners... other girls bags..NOTHING. At this point I am disgusted!! Now my daughter is leaving barefoot to get to the car?? Are you serious?? My husband calls a dance teacher who is the owners Barry's daughter..as useful as a brick wall! I expressed my frustration and include it is ridiculous that you pay hundreds of dollars and now how to worry about petty theft.... seriously! ! I also included this is why I prefer my child to bring her personals with her to class so they are safe. She wanted to know why am I getting mad at her...does she want me to give my daughter her shoes so she can get home?? Matter of fact..YES!!! The owner Barry could care less..until I posted on their site a review outlining our experience and suggesting whom ever took the shoes bring them back and teach their daughter about stealing. Low and behold my husband gets a call after my post 3 hrs later indicating they found my daughters shoes in the corner?!?! The same corner I looked in myself?!?! What a miracle... and that my daughter can leave their school !!! This place has no integrity. Come to find out through other parents who also have children that go their that theft is a regular thing and they don't do much about it! So I guess it must be very annoying for someone like me to speak up about the principal of things. Barry did refund my husband for costume fees..However I will be pursuing the rest of my fees via small claims court.

My daughter has been with TDI for 6+ years, they have always been fantastic! Warm and welcoming,…read moreamazing teachers and families. I am really glad we found this studio (we saw a couple of dancers competing at the CNE, and found out they were in Scarborough which was perfect for us!). We began our competitive journey last year, and my daughter absolutely loves it! Monika, the director is amazing! I highly recommend this studio, they have expanded the Tap programme now to the really young kiddos now too. Don't be afraid to chat with other parents there, we are all friendly! The studio has a great reputation, anytime we mention which studio we are with, people always say how amazing they are and how respect the dancers are...how we clap for everyone at competitions and congratulate other dancers. Anyways, wanted to leave this review because I noticed a negative one. Socialize with other parents, talk to the teachers etc....The cutest thing happened after my daughter did her first solo ever and in competition in March of this year, her entire team had run to watch her and then they came out and gave her a huge group hug when she finished!! Anyways, both recreational and competitive streams are fantastic!
